Brownie Christmas Tree Cookies Recipe

Description

Create festive and delicious Brownie Christmas Trees using baked brownie mix circles stacked and decorated with green frosting, holiday sprinkles, and yellow star toppers, perfect for holiday parties and celebrations.


Ingredients

Scale

Brownie Base

  • 1 box brownie mix any brand, baked and cooled
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 3 tablespoons water
  • 3 round cookie/biscuit cutters in varying sizes

Green Frosting

  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1/2 cup butter softened to room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2-3 tablespoons milk
  • green food coloring
  • disposable piping bag
  • Wilton Star tip 1m

Decorations

  • holiday sprinkles
  • yellow star toppers


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Green Frosting: In a mixing bowl, combine the powdered sugar, softened butter, and vanilla extract. Gradually add 1 tablespoon of milk at a time and mix until the frosting reaches a smooth, pipeable consistency. Add green food coloring until the desired shade is achieved.
  2. Fill the Piping Bag: Attach the Wilton Star tip 1m to the disposable piping bag and fill it with the prepared green frosting.
  3. Cut the Brownie Circles: Using the three different sized round cookie cutters, gently cut out brownie circles from the baked and cooled brownie sheet.
  4. Assemble the Brownie Christmas Trees: Starting with the largest brownie circle, place it on your serving tray and pipe frosting on top. Stack the medium and then the smallest brownie circle on top, each separated with a layer of frosting to resemble a Christmas tree shape.
  5. Decorate the Trees: Pipe additional frosting on the top of the smallest brownie circle to form the tree's peak. Add a yellow star topper and sprinkle holiday sprinkles onto the frosting to add festive decoration.
  6. Repeat: Repeat the assembly and decorating process with the remaining brownie circles until all trees are formed.

Notes

  • Ensure brownies are fully cooled before cutting to prevent crumbling.
  • Adjust the frosting consistency with milk for easier piping if needed.
  • Use any holiday-themed sprinkles you prefer for decoration.
  • The star toppers can be edible sugar stars or decorative picks.
  • For a gluten-free version, use a gluten-free brownie mix.
